Firmware parameter configuration method and device and electronic equipment
A technology of firmware parameters and configuration methods, which is applied in the computer field and can solve problems such as insecurity
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0033] like figure 1 As shown, according to a firmware parameter configuration system 10 described in the embodiment of the present invention, the firmware parameter configuration system 10 includes built-in parameters, 101 and external parameter configuration files 102, wherein the built-in parameter table 101 is solidified in the firmware code , the external parameter configuration file 102 is not solidified in the code, the built-in parameter table 101 is generated when the firmware is compiled, and the external parameter configuration file 102 is generated by using the upper computer parameter configuration table generation software.
[0034] The firmware parameter configuration system 10 of the present embodiment is mainly used for initializing the CPU and peripherals etc. when the BIOS starts. It should be understood that the system on chip SOC (system on chip) is also used to perform work similar to the CPU, and the difference is only in the integration of the SOC. Othe...
Embodiment 2
[0059] refer to Figure 4 , the present embodiment provides a firmware parameter configuration device 30, which includes the following units:
[0060] A startup acquiring unit 31, configured to acquire startup operations;
[0061] A private key obtaining unit 32, configured to obtain the first private key from the read-only ROM in response to the startup operation;
[0062] The decoding parameter unit 33 is used to decode the built-in parameter table according to the first private key, and obtain the first parameter and the secondary private key;
[0063] The parameter obtaining unit 34 is used to decrypt the external parameter table using the secondary private key through the index to obtain the second parameter; wherein the external parameter table is the same as the internal parameter table of the firmware, and the second parameter is the same as the first parameter Constitute a complete hardware configuration parameter;
[0064] The configuration unit 35 is configured t...
Embodiment 3
[0070] refer to Figure 5 , an electronic device 20 , and this embodiment provides a schematic structural diagram of the electronic device 20 . The electronic device 20 of this embodiment includes a processor 21 , a memory 22 and a computer program stored in the memory 22 and executable on the processor 21 . When the processor 21 executes the computer program, the steps in the above-mentioned electronic method embodiments are implemented, for example image 3 Step S1 is shown.
[0071] Exemplarily, the computer program can be divided into one or more modules / units, and the one or more modules / units are stored in the memory 22 and executed by the processor 21 to complete this invention. The one or more modules / units may be a series of computer program instruction segments capable of accomplishing specific functions, and the instruction segments are used to describe the execution process of the computer program in the electronic device 20 .
[0072] The electronic device 20 ...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


